Prohibitory orders extended up to Wednesday Morning

In view of the incidents in Belagavi city with respect to defacing the statue of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j in Bengaluru and subsequently, of the statue of Veer Sangolli Rayanna prohibitory orders imposed under section 144 CrPC have been EXTENDED to Wednesday 0600 hrs for Belagavi police commissionerate area.

What is Sec 144?

Section 144 of the Criminal Procedure Code (CrPC) of 1973 authorizes the Executive Magistrate of any state or territory to issue an order to prohibit the assembly of four or more people in an area. According to the law, every member of such ‘unlawful assembly can be booked for engaging in rioting.

Section 144 is imposed in urgent cases of nuisance or apprehended danger of some event that has the potential to cause trouble or damage to human life or property. Section 144 of CrPC generally prohibits public gathering.
